Open Vishal1541 opened 5 years ago
@kpbot claim
Hello @dheeraj135!
You have attempted to claim an issue without the labels "help wanted", "good first issue". It seems like you are new to KamandPrompt, so we suggest working on an issue with the help wanted or good first issue label first.
To claim this issue anyway, comment on this issue again with the command @kpbot claim --force
.
@kpbot claim --force
Welcome to KamandPrompt, @dheeraj135! We just sent you an invite to collaborate on this repository at https://github.com/KamandPrompt/CodeManiacs/invitations. Please accept this invite in order to claim this issue and begin a fun, rewarding experience contributing to KamandPrompt!
Here's some tips to get you off to a good start:
See you on the other side (that is, the pull request side)!
Hi, In the problem setter field, we are storing the name of the user. Now, the username is not guaranteed to be unique. I suggest we should store username in the problem setter field.
Benefits:
Is there any particular reason to use user instead of username?
@dheeraj135 Yes, this was supposed to be done and with the previous contributors we had discussed about it but due to some reason there was no progress. You can take up this one :+1:
Hello @dheeraj135, you have been unassigned from this issue because you have not updated this issue or any referenced pull requests for over 7 days.
You can reclaim this issue or claim any other issue by commenting @kpbot claim
on that issue.
Thanks for your contributions, and hope to see you again soon!
Currently, there is only one level of the admin who has all the privileges to add, remove other admins, problems and contests. To come up with a better approach, admins should have 2 levels:
Level1: is the supreme admin who has all the privileges to add, remove other users as admins, can see, modify, delete every problem and the contests.
Level2: is the problem setter who can just see, add, remove, modify only his problems and contests and cannot even see other admins.